Marcin Kaszkiel is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computer Networks and Communications and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Marcin Kaszkiel has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 395 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 6 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 4 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Marcin Kaszkiel's work include Algorithms and Data Compression (5 papers), Information Retrieval and Search Behavior (4 papers) and Advanced Database Systems and Queries (4 papers). Marcin Kaszkiel is often cited by papers focused on Algorithms and Data Compression (5 papers), Information Retrieval and Search Behavior (4 papers) and Advanced Database Systems and Queries (4 papers). Marcin Kaszkiel collaborates with scholars based in Australia and United States. Marcin Kaszkiel's co-authors include Justin Zobel, Amit Singhal, Ron Sacks‐Davis, Ross Wilkinson, Mingfang Wu, Michael Fuller and John Robertson and has published in prestigious journals such as ACM Transactions on Information Systems, ACM SIGIR Forum and Journal of the American Society for Information Science and Technology.
